Abstract: | A new process is proposed for refining niobite ore that is found in Jiangxi province of China. Niobite, also known as columbite or niobite–tantalite, is a mineral that contains tantalum and niobium. The separation process includes two-stage grinding, gravity concentration, magnetic separation, and flotation. The tantalum/niobium concentrate obtained had a grade of Ta2O5 18.28%, Nb2O5 41.62% at a recovery rate of Ta2O5 49.08%, Nb2O5 70.77%. Other minerals occurring along with the niobite, such as zinnwaldite, feldspar, and quartz, were also recovered to comprehensively utilize this ore. |
